Within the right lung, the lateral segmental bronchus (bronchus segmentalis lateralis) is shown branching from the segmental bronchus of the middle lobe and coursing laterally toward the costal surface. Proximally it lies inferior to the right superior lobar bronchus and anterior to the bronchus intermedius, then divides distally into smaller subsegmental bronchi that track with the lateral segmental pulmonary artery and veins. Orientation is referenced to the hilum medially and the pleura laterally, with the airway lumen presented as a bronchial tube rather than an alveolar field. Right-sided bronchial anatomy is the point. Segmental bronchi define bronchopulmonary segments, the surgical and radiologic units used for targeted resection and airway localization. Accurate identification of the right middle lobe lateral segment matters during bronchoscopy for mucus plugging or aspirated foreign body retrieval, and it guides thoracic surgeons planning a segmentectomy when disease is confined to a single segment. Radiologists also rely on this branching pattern to map atelectasis, post-obstructive pneumonia, or endobronchial tumor to a specific segment on CT and to correlate it with ventilation patterns.
